First step to get rid of life-threatening cyst

[caption id="attachment_36200" align="alignright" width="300"] NEW HOPE: Angelique Glass has an ear cyst which is pressing into her brain, causing deafness and facial paralysis -[/caption]

A PORT Elizabeth woman with a rare ear condition will have an expensive scan this week to determine the severity of her condition.

The South African ambassador in Rome, Tembi Tambo, has offered to pay the R6000 so Angelique Glass can have the scan.

Glass's father-in-law, Barry Glass, said they had been in touch with Tambo, daughter of the late ANC stalwart Oliver Tambo, and sent her the doctor's details for payment.

They have booked the scan for later this week. - Estelle Ellis
